How much do international project engineer jobs pay per year?

As of Sep 2, 2026, the average yearly pay for international project engineer in Florida is $88,053.00, according to ZipRecruiter salary data. Most workers in this role earn between $77,700.00 and $99,000.00 per year, depending on experience, location, and employer.

What is an international project engineer?

International Project Engineers are professionals responsible for managing and overseeing engineering projects that span multiple countries or regions. They coordinate technical tasks, ensure compliance with international standards, and handle cross-cultural communication between teams. Their role often involves traveling, working with diverse stakeholders, and adapting to different regulatory environments. International Project Engineers play a key role in delivering projects on time and within budget, while maintaining quality and safety standards.

What does an international project engineer do?

As an international project engineer, your responsibilities include being the manager of an overseas construction project. These projects can range from residential buildings to complex infrastructure programs like bridges and tunnels. Your first duties include bidding and negotiating potential projects. After winning a job, you plan the budget, organize the project, schedule vendors, check technical aspects, and follow up on design and construction progress. You are expected to facilitate communication between customers, vendors, and others, maintain cost control and profitability, and create and monitor project timelines. This job requires travel.

What are the key skills and qualifications needed to thrive as an international project engineer, and why are they important?

To thrive as an International Project Engineer, you need a solid background in engineering principles, project management, and global standards, usually supported by a relevant engineering degree and experience in international projects. Familiarity with project management software (such as MS Project or Primavera), CAD tools, and certifications like PMP or Prince2 is often required. Strong intercultural communication, adaptability, and problem-solving skills help you navigate diverse teams and complex project environments. These capabilities are crucial for delivering successful projects on time and within budget across different countries and regulatory frameworks.

What are some common challenges faced by international project engineers when managing cross-border projects?

International Project Engineers often encounter challenges such as coordinating across time zones, navigating cultural differences, and ensuring compliance with varying local regulations and standards. Effective communication is vital, as collaborating with diverse teams and stakeholders can sometimes lead to misunderstandings or delays. Additionally, adapting to unexpected logistical issues—like supply chain disruptions or permitting delays—requires strong problem-solving skills and flexibility. Building strong relationships and staying proactive are key to overcoming these hurdles and ensuring project success.

What is the difference between International Project Engineer vs Project Engineer?

AspectInternational Project EngineerProject Engineer
CredentialsBachelor's degree in engineering, certifications like PMP or PE often preferred, international experienceBachelor's degree in engineering or related field, PMP certification beneficial
Work EnvironmentGlobal projects, travel abroad, multicultural teamsLocal or regional projects, office and site work
Employer & Industry UsageConstruction, manufacturing, energy sectors with international operationsConstruction, civil, mechanical, or electrical projects primarily local or national

The main difference is that an International Project Engineer manages projects across multiple countries, often requiring international experience and travel, while a Project Engineer typically focuses on local or regional projects within a specific area. Both roles require engineering expertise and project management skills, but the scope and work environment vary significantly.

Job description

Role Overview
The GT Senior Project Engineer leads the engineering and design team, assuming overall
responsibility for successful technical project execution. The GT Senior Project Engineer
acts as a liaison between the engineering team, project management and the customer
with the responsibility for integrating the various engineering, scheduling, and purchasing
aspect of the project in accordance with contract obligations. Familiarity with gas turbine
and gas turbine auxiliaries design and construction are required (mechanical, electrical,
and I&C). Familiarity with Steam turbine, Generator, and BOP design and construction is
desirable.
Key Responsibilities
  • Demonstrates our core competencies: Action oriented, change champion,
  • customer-focused, developing self & others, and ownership
  • Serve as the primary technical point of contact for EPC partners, Owner's
  • Engineers, and Customers, interpreting and integrating design requirements from
  • customers or parent company in accordance with contract specifications.
  • Lead planning, setup, and monitoring of project engineering systems, including
  • kick-offs, MDLs, DORs, contract deviation lists, and inter-discipline workflows;
  • coordinate engineering activities and resolve cross-disciplinary issues.
  • Translate contract requirements and scope of work into actionable engineering
  • deliverables for discipline teams, ensuring alignment with contractual obligations.
  • Monitor engineering schedules, budgets, and estimates through project
  • completion, including periodic reviews, two-week look-ahead planning,
  • expediting activities, escalation of action items, and preparation of technical
  • delivery status reports.
  • Support Project Managers and Lead Project Engineers in tracking and assessing
  • design changes, engineering change notices (ECNs), and contract deviations,
  • including impact evaluation.
  • Coordinate regularly with international affiliated companies to support successful
  • engineering execution and project delivery.
  • Review and comment on project documents and drawings to ensure compliance
  • with contractual document flow and technical requirements.
  • Support equipment specification, bid evaluation, vendor selection, and capacity
  • assessments for MPWA-sourced equipment on Gas Turbine and Combined Cycle
  • projects.
  • Maintain working knowledge of applicable engineering codes and standards for
  • combustion turbines and auxiliary systems, including ASME, ANSI, AWS, API,
  • ASTM, NFPA, and NEC.
  • Collaborate with Global Sourcing, Quality Assurance, and Project Management to
  • coordinate vendors and subcontractors throughout execution.
  • Support Application Engineering in reviewing and evaluating customer
  • specifications in coordination with the parent company, as required.
  • Track and resolve open technical and contractual items through project
  • completion and into the warranty period, ensuring closure of outstanding issues.
  • Demonstrate strong multitasking and multidisciplinary communication skills
  • across engineering, sourcing, and project teams.

Requirements
  • Bachelor's degree in Engineering required; Master's degree in Engineering preferred.
  • 10-20 years of directly related technical experience in engineering or power project execution.
  • Professional Engineer (P.E.) license required.
  • Experience with SP3D and other 3D design tools such as SmartPlant or PDMS.
  • Knowledge of ISO procedures and OSHA safety requirements.
  • International business experience, including collaboration with global teams.
  • Proficiency with project management and office tools, including MS Project,
  • Excel, Word, Outlook, Visio, and technical diagrams/flowcharts.
  • Strong technical interpretation skills, with the ability to analyze complex instructions presented in mathematical or diagrammatic form and manage both abstract and practical variables.
  • Japanese and/or Spanish language fluency is a plus.
  • Willingness to travel to customer offices and construction sites as required.
